How they compare
Dominica currently reports 17.6% against 17.0% in Georgia, a difference of 0.6%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 30 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Georgia ahead.
Dominica ranks 97th and Georgia ranks 100th of 193 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Dominica averaged higher in 1 and Georgia in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Dominica | Georgia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 5.4% | 6.2% | 0.8% | Georgia |
| 2000s | 10.0% | 11.2% | 1.2% | Georgia |
| 2010s | 15.7% | 15.5% | 0.2% | Dominica |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
